DirecTV is an American digital entertainment services provider headquartered in Englewood, Colorado. The company specializes in satellite television and digital television entertainment, offering a wide range of programming that includes sports, news, movies, and family content. DirecTV provides both live TV and streaming services, along with on-demand options, allowing customers to access their preferred entertainment without the need for an annual contract. Additionally, the company features live NFL games, ensuring that sports enthusiasts can enjoy comprehensive coverage of their favorite events. Through its continuous evolution of products and services, DirecTV aims to deliver an industry-leading video offering to its customers.

PrimeStar was a U.S. direct broadcast satellite broadcasting company formed in 1991 by a consortium of cable television system operators. PrimeStar was the first medium-powered DBS system in the United States but slowly declined in popularity with the arrival of DirecTV in 1994 and Dish Network in 1996.

USSB was founded in 1981 by Hubbard Broadcasting founder Stanley S. Hubbard, who is widely considered to be the father of modern satellite broadcasting. Hubbard spent most of the 1980s raising awareness and money to launch a digital satellite television service. In the 1990s, he had teamed up with RCA/Thomson Consumer Electronics and Hughes Electronics Corporation to come up with a practical digital satellite service capable of 175 channels.
